【经典的嵌入式linux的书籍推荐】在嵌入式Linux开发领域,选择一本合适的书籍对于初学者和进阶者都至关重要。好的书籍不仅能帮助读者系统地掌握基础知识,还能提升实际开发能力。以下是一些被广泛认可的经典嵌入式Linux相关书籍,涵盖从基础到高级的内容。
一、
嵌入式Linux涉及硬件与软件的结合,学习过程中需要兼顾操作系统原理、驱动开发、系统移植等多个方面。因此,推荐的书籍应具备结构清晰、内容全面、实例丰富等特点。以下书籍涵盖了嵌入式Linux的核心知识点,适合不同层次的学习者。
二、经典书籍推荐表
书名 | 作者 | 出版社 | 内容简介 | 适合人群 |
《嵌入式Linux开发实战》 | 张晓东 | 电子工业出版社 | 本书详细介绍了嵌入式Linux系统的构建、内核配置、驱动编写等内容,配有大量实践案例。 | 初学者、有一定C语言基础的开发者 |
《Linux设备驱动开发详解》 | 李云 | 机械工业出版社 | 聚焦于Linux设备驱动的开发,讲解了字符设备、块设备、网络设备等的实现方式。 | 驱动开发人员、系统工程师 |
《Linux内核源代码情景分析》 | 毛德操、胡希明 | 浙江大学出版社 | 通过分析Linux内核源码,深入理解其运行机制和设计思想。 | 对内核有浓厚兴趣的开发者 |
《嵌入式Linux系统开发技术》 | 王永康 | 清华大学出版社 | 从硬件平台搭建到系统移植,全面覆盖嵌入式Linux开发流程。 | 入门及中阶开发者 |
《Linux系统编程》 | Robert Love | 人民邮电出版社(中文版) | 介绍Linux下进程、线程、信号、文件I/O等系统编程知识,是开发高效程序的基础。 | 系统编程爱好者 |
《嵌入式系统:Linux环境下的开发与应用》 | 刘洪涛 | 北京航空航天大学出版社 | 结合具体项目,讲述嵌入式系统的设计与实现过程。 | 工程师、项目开发人员 |
三、结语
以上书籍均为嵌入式Linux领域的经典之作,无论是作为教材还是参考书,都能为学习者提供扎实的知识基础和实用的开发经验。建议根据自身需求选择合适的书籍进行深入学习,并结合实际项目加以巩固。